What Solskjaer Said On Man Utd Penalty Taker After Rashford Misses Against Palace

Manchester United manager, Ole Gunnar Solskjaer, has put faith in Marcus Rashford to take the team’s next penalty, after his miss against Crystal Palace on Saturday, the UK Independent reports.

The 21-year-old made no mistake from 12 yards against Chelsea on the opening weekend.

And when United were awarded a penalty during their 1-1 draw with Wolves last Monday, he was expected to assume responsibility.

But Paul Pogba stepped up and saw his kick saved by Rui Patricio.

When United were awarded another penalty against Palace on Saturday, Rashford grabbed the ball, only to see his effort come crashing off the post.

Consecutive failures to convert from the spot have cost Manchester United points in their previous two games, but Solskjaer is not concerned about the issue and has told Rashford to continue taking penalties.
